Job description

Payroll Analyst

Location: Irvine, CA

Pay: $30-$35/hr

Benefits: This position is eligible for medical, dental, vision, and 401(k).

Position Overview

The Payroll Analyst is responsible for supporting and executing payroll operations, with a primary focus on provider (Doctor/Clinician) payroll processes. This role manages payroll activities related to provider compensation, including contract setup, incentive calculations, draws/advances, and final pay processing. The Payroll Analyst will collaborate closely with Operations, Legal, Accounting, HR, and IT teams to ensure accurate, timely, and compliant payroll processing while delivering exceptional customer service and issue resolution.

The ideal candidate will have 4–6 years of progressive payroll experience, strong analytical skills, advanced Excel capabilities, and experience supporting multi-state payroll environments. Workday Payroll experience is highly preferred.

Qualifications & Requirements
  • 4–6 years of progressive payroll experience with hands-on payroll processing and analysis experience.
  • Advanced Excel skills required, including VLOOKUPs, Pivot Tables, IF statements, and data analysis.
  • Multi-state payroll experience preferred.
  • Workday Payroll experience a strong plus, but not required.
  • Certified Payroll Professional (CPP) certification preferred; candidates actively pursuing CPP certification are encouraged to apply.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Human Resources, or related field preferred. In lieu of a degree, 6+ years of relevant payroll experience required.
  • Strong knowledge of federal, state, and local payroll regulations and compliance requirements.
  • Understanding of payroll accounting, GAAP principles, and general ledger journal entries.
  • Experience supporting payroll operations within a healthcare, dental, retail, or multi-location environment preferred.
  • Experience with payroll systems, reporting, and data analysis tools.
Major Responsibilities
  • Manage payroll-related inquiries from clinicians and providers through case management ticketing systems, ensuring timely and accurate resolution.
  • Support the review, setup, and maintenance of provider (Doctor/Clinician) contracts within the Provider Compensation system.
  • Assist with the setup and maintenance of RDH incentive contracts, including calculation validation and payroll system entry.
  • Support monthly incentive processing and semi-monthly draw/advance payroll activities.
  • Prepare and validate payroll files while ensuring accurate final pay calculations for provider terminations.
  • Process additional compensation payments, including training pay, sick pay, honorariums, and other supplemental earnings, ensuring appropriate documentation and approvals.
  • Assist with provider payroll processes related to overpayment recovery and resolution.
  • Provide payroll guidance and communicate policies and procedures to Regional Partners, Regional Managers, and field teams.
  • Compile payroll data and reports for internal departments and business needs.
  • Maintain compliance with payroll policies, regulatory requirements, and SOX controls.
  • Perform additional payroll-related duties and special projects as assigned.
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
  • Strong understanding of payroll processes, compliance requirements, and best practices.
  • Excellent analytical skills with the ability to identify discrepancies, research issues, and recommend solutions.
  • Advanced attention to detail with strong organizational and time-management sk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ities while maintaining accuracy and meeting deadlines.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ills with the ability to interact effectively with employees, management, vendors, and regulatory agencies.
  • Ability to work independently, make sound decisions, and resolve issues with limited direction.
  • Customer-service focused with a proactive, process-improvement mindset.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and ability to analyze complex payroll data.
